Transaction 53a3983185d04c8be551ac7749a285f4ebf353b1b179a50ef7ef864bc23e8830
1 Input
1 Output
-
53a3983185d04c8be551ac7749a285f4ebf353b1b179a50ef7ef864bc23e8830:0
- value
- 698645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 916f4b77ab995b917f07c7835bb7008811474284 OP_EQUAL
- address
- 3Ex1EFs3ZSLNcVhov2MeDxiGtzhyJFfMWg